How do hurricanes hurt the state of lousiana
Korolek [52]

Answer:

Their powerful winds, rainfall and rushing floodwater can do enough harm to permanently remove land. The pounding surf can break down marshes' soft sediments and thick mats of dead grass, which are pliable and easily reshaped.

According to Gestalt psychology, how does Sinead know that the snake is not broken into individual segments?
kondaur [170]

According to Gestalt psychology, Sinead knows that the snake is not broken into individual segments by "​The Principle of Continuity".

<h3>What is Gestalt psychology?</h3>

Gestalt psychology would be a philosophy of thought that examines the entire spectrum of human cognition and behavior.

Some key features of Gestalt psychology are-

  • Gestalt psychology says that we do not merely concentrate on every minor detail while attempting to figure out what is going on around us.
  • Instead, we have a tendency to think of things as parts of larger, more intricate systems.
  • Holism, or the idea that the whole is beyond the sum of the its parts, is a fundamental principle of Gestalt psychology.
  • The modern advancement in the study of human perception and sensation has been greatly influenced by this school of psychology.
  • Gestalt psychology was developed under the influence of several philosophers, namely Immanuel Kant, Ernst Mach, & Johann Wolfgang von Goethe.
